Footnotes
CHAOS COMIN showed the way in the two path, drew away while in hand around the turn, was asked for more run at the top of the lane, and continued kicking away to be much the best. POWER WRENCH stalked an inner pair, rounded the turn while under a ride in the three path, was no match for the winner, but kept on to get up for place around the sixteenth. FAST PRINCE rated inside, came under a ride while off the rail passing the three-eighths pole, and stayed on up the inside down the lane for show. POLIZON broke out at the start, pressed the outer winning pacesetter while pushed along from the rail entering the turn, could not keep up with that rival rounding the turn, floated out to the three path entering the stretch, and faded. LUCHO steadied at the start, trailed in the three path, was coaxed along from the two path around the turn, but did not threaten. ALEXANDER K got herded out at the start, chased in the two path, was driven in the three path around the turn, but retreated.
